    68-year-old man dead in Jamestown shooting
    BUFFALO, N.Y. (WIVB) — A Jamestown man is dead following a shooting on Tuesday night, according to police.Police responded to the area of Newland Avenue and Forest Avenue around 8:40 p.m. Tuesday, where a man identified as 68-year-old Doug Howie had been shot.He was transported to UPMC Chautauqua and then airlifted to Hamot Medical Center in Erie, Pa., where he was pronounced dead.The shooting is still under investigation.   • 3 homes, 2 garages, vehicle damaged in fire in Amherst

    3 homes, 2 garages, vehicle damaged in fire in Amherst
    BUFFALO, N.Y. (WIVB) — Three homes, two garages and a vehicle suffered damage in a fire in Amherst early Wednesday morning, according to fire officials.Crews responded to 210 Windermere Blvd. around 2:05 a.m., Wednesday, where a vehicle had caught fire and had spread to the home and garage.
    The fire had also extended to two other single family homes, 216 Windermere and 243 Capen Blvd., as well as the garage of one of the homes.
